Case 144/2024 Summary: The court stopped proceedings against Ram Laxman Hirave under Section 258 of the Criminal Procedure Code for violations of the Maharashtra Prohibition Act, due to the prosecution's failure to secure his presence despite repeated process issuance and absence of a Chargesheet report. The accused was discharged, and seized property was directed to be forwarded to the State Excise Department for disposal after the appeal period.
